About Young Wook Lee
Young Wook Lee is a scholar working on Materials Chemistry, Renewable Energy, Sustainability and the Environment,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ials, Organic Chemistry and Electrical and Electronic Engineering, having authored 81 papers that have together received 4.2k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Electrocatalysts for Energy Conversion (45 papers), Catalytic Processes in Materials Science (30 papers), Gold and Silver Nanoparticles Synthesis and Applications (24 papers), Nanomaterials for catalytic reactions (23 papers), Nanocluster Synthesis and Applications (15 papers), Advanced battery technologies research (11 papers), Copper-based nanomaterials and applications (8 papers) and Electrochemical Analysis and Applications (7 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Renewable Energy, Sustainability and the Environment (2.0k citations), Electrochemistry (555 citations),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ials (1.2k citations), Materials Chemistry (2.6k citations) and Organic Chemistry (1.0k citations). Young Wook Lee has collaborated with scholars based in South Korea, United States and Canada. Frequent co-authors include Sang Woo Han, Shin Wook Kang, Jong Wook Hong, Minjung Kim, Minjung Kim, Dongheun Kim, Yena Kim, Su‐Un Lee, Zee Hwan Kim and Kihyun Kwon. Their work appears in journals such as ACS Applied Materials & Interfaces, Chemical Communications, Chemical Physics Letters, Angewandte Chemie International Edition and Small.
